Museo Nazionale del Bargello
The Museo Nazionale del Bargello, located in the heart of Florence, is one of the most significant museums in Italy, renowned for its impressive collection of Renaissance sculptures. Housed in a former barracks and prison, the museum's architecture is as captivating as the art it contains. Visitors can marvel at masterpieces by renowned artists such as Donatello, Michelangelo, and Cellini, showcasing the evolution of sculpture from the Middle Ages to the Renaissance. The museum's collection includes not only sculptures but also decorative arts, including ceramics, textiles, and metalwork, providing a comprehensive view of the artistic achievements of the period. The Bargello's intimate setting allows for a close-up experience with the artworks, making it a favorite among art enthusiasts. The museum also features a beautiful courtyard, perfect for a moment of reflection amidst the artistic splendor. As you wander through the halls, you will encounter the famous 'David' by Donatello, a pivotal work that influenced generations of artists. The museum's rich history and its role in the cultural heritage of Florence make it a must-visit destination for anyone interested in art and history. A visit to the Bargello is not just about viewing art; it's about immersing oneself in the story of Florence's artistic legacy.
